There are certain special visa exemptions for travelers from various countries entering Morocco. For travelers from most countries in the North America, South America, Europe, and the Gulf countries, no visa is required. You can check for the list of countries with visa exemption to Morocco by referring to this Wikipedia page. If you’re from any other country that is not mentioned here, you need to obtain the visa before boarding your flight. While obtaining the visa, you’ll need to fulfill various Morocco visa requirements depending on the purpose and duration of your travel.
However, visa-free access is applicable only till 90 days. So, if your stay in Morocco extends for more than 90 days, you’ll need to obtain a resident permit, which can be obtained from a local police station in Morocco.
MANDATORY MOROCCO VISA REQUIREMENTS
Now, if you are from a country that requires a pre-approved visa to enter Morocco, here is a list of mandatory Morocco visa requirements that you’ll need to have.
- Application form: The application form is one of the most important Morocco visa requirement in the case of nationals who do not have a visa-free entry. You’ll need to submit three visa application forms. The visa application forms need to be completely filled and duly signed. Remember that you need to keep at least one original form, while the rest of the two can be photocopied from the original.
- Valid Passport: A valid passport is one of the most important travel documents you need to carry while abroad. This applies even if you have a visa-free access to Morocco. So, ensure that your passport is valid for at least 6 months from the date of your return and that it has a minimum of 2 blank pages. Along with your valid passport, you’ll also need to keep a copy of the first page of the passport that contains your photo.
- Passport-sized photographs: You need to submit at least 4 passport-sized photographs along with your visa application. Being an inevitable Morocco visa requirement, you need to take particular care that the photo is taken recently (within the last six months) and is clearly identifiable with your face. Ensure that the photographs are in colour and adhere to the international passport-sized photo specifications.
- Proof of return: When you enter Morocco, you need to guarantee the immigration officer that you have plans for your return. - Personal covering letter: The covering letter is a letter that briefly states your purpose of visiting Morocco and other relevant details, such as the duration of your stay, your accommodation arrangements, the places you intend to visit, the people you’re planning to meet, the flight numbers for your return journey, as well as a brief about your means of financial subsistence while in Morocco.
ADDITIONAL MOROCCO VISA REQUIREMENTS, DEPENDING ON THE NATURE OF VISIT
While the aforementioned documents are the mandatory Morocco visa requirements for all visa types, there are certain other documents you’ll need to submit depending on the nature and purpose of your visit. These are:
- For tourists: If you’re a tourist planning to visit Morocco, you’ll need to submit your hotel reservation receipt. This should be for the entire duration of your stay in Morocco. In case you’re being sponsored by a Moroccan resident, you can get a notarized invitation letter from your sponsor in Morocco to prove that the sponsor will take care of your accommodation arrangements.
- For business owners: If you’re on a business trip to Morocco, you’ll need to prove the existence of your company as well as some other documents. If you own the business, you’ll need to show the registration documents for your business, as well as your Income Tax Returns Certificate, for the past two years. However, if you’re representing a business organisation for the trip, you’ll need to prove the evidence of your employment or contract with the company you’re representing.
- For employees: If you’re an employee planning to visit Morocco, you’ll need to provide proof of your employment as well as the No Objection Certificate from your employer.
- For job visa application: In order to be able to pursue your career in Morocco, you’ll need to apply for a job visa by furnishing your offer letter from the company in Morocco, your work permit, and the employment contract with the Moroccan company.
- For student visa application: If you’re a student planning to continue your studies in Morocco, you’ll need to provide the enrollment letter from the educational institution in Morocco, along with the other mandatory documents.
- For spouses of Moroccan citizens: If you’re the spouse of a Moroccan citizen who is planning to stay/visit Morocco, you’ll need to submit your Marriage Certificate as well as a valid ID proof of the Moroccan spouse, along with all the mandatory Morocco visa requirements.
